
Harmony Menopause Day & Night
Ingredients (per tablet)
Day tablet
Rehmannia glutinosa root: 1.2g, Vitex agnus-castus fruit (Chaste Tree): 100mg, Angelica polymorpha root (Dong Quai): 200mg, Dioscorea opposita root (Chinese Yam): 200mg, Paeonia lactiflora root (Peony): 200mg, Bupleurum falcatum root: 200mg, Calcium hydrogen phosphate: 350gm. Equiv calcium 81.6mg, Calcium amino acid chelate: 50mg. Equiv calcium 10mg, Magnesium amino acid chelate:50mg. Equiv magnesium 10mg), Cholecalciferol: 2.5mcg (Vitamin D3 100IU)
Night tablet
Rehmannia glutinosa root: 7.6g, Ziziphus jujube seed: 10g.
Suggested Use
Take 2 DAY tablets in the morning.
Take 1 NIGHT tablet in the evening.
Or take as directed by your healthcare practitioner.
Tablets can be taken with water or juice, before meals or at least one hour after meals.
Caution
Discontinue use if pregnancy occurs or you develop sensitivity to the formula.
If you are taking a course of hormone medication, seek advice from your prescribing practitioner.
